Abstract
This article discusses the potentialities and limitations of using artificial intelligence (AI) in educational assessment. We examine how AI can provide functions such as automation of assessment processes, personalization of student learning, and real-time feedback to teachers and students. Nevertheless, we problematize ethical and practical challenges, such as limitations in understanding social, cultural, and emotional contexts, the reinforcements of biases, and the possibility of undermining the teachers work. In the face of this, we argue the need for careful use of AI to complement and enhance teaching activities and ensure human interaction as a core characteristic of educational processes
